Entry requirements

Entry requirements set by ASQA are the basic qualifications and criteria that students must meet before enrolling in a nationally recognised course.

These requirements ensure students have the skills and knowledge needed to undertake this course.

  • There are no formal academic requirements
  • Additional entry requirements are set by individual course providers

More about Certificate III in Recreational Vehicle Manufacturing

If you're considering a career in the exciting field of recreational vehicle manufacturing, obtaining the Certificate III in Recreational Vehicle Manufacturing in Tamworth is an excellent place to start. This qualification is designed to equip students with essential skills and knowledge, ideal for pursuing roles in the manufacturing sector. In Tamworth, there are specialised training providers, including TAFE NSW, TAFE Queensland, and NS, all offering courses through an online delivery mode, making it accessible for local students.

By studying the Certificate III in Recreational Vehicle Manufacturing, you'll gain valuable insights that can lead you to roles such as an Apprentice Caravan Mechanic or a Sheet Metal Worker. These positions not only offer a chance to develop specialised skills but also allow you to contribute significantly to the automotive and manufacturing fields.
